Even after a restful night’s sleep, you can wake with red, puffy eyes that make you look and feel tired –especially during allergy season. Try the THERA°PEARL Eye Mask to help your puffy eyes look and feel better every day.

The mask can be used cold or hot. Use cold to help relieve puffy eyes and those wicked sinus headaches. It takes the sting out of a brow wax and helps reduce swelling after a cosmetic procedure (in such a case, use the mask as directed by your doctor). The heat helps relieve dry eye symptoms associated with Meibomian Gland Dysfunction or MGD and Blepharitis, reduces nasal congestion, and relieves soreness once the swelling is gone.

Chill it in the freezer or fridge or pop it into the microwave. Place it over your eyes and sinuses, or slide it up to your forehead. Its pliable, face-hugging shape stays put without drips or leaks. The therapeutic temperature should be applied no more than the doctor’s recommended time of 20 minutes.

I also keep a stash of these eye wipes in my bag, and in our medicine cabinet. They are soft, gentle, cooling, and perfect for wiping irritated and sore eyes and they are designed to be safe to use when wearing contact lenses which is essential for me.

Biotrue Daily Eyelid Wipes are created by Bausch & Lomb in response to the problem of making sure the eyelids are kept free of dirt, and debris, without disturbing the actual contact lens.

These wipes have been designed by leaders in the field of eye care, in order to give relief to those with Ocular Allergy, Blepharitis, and other infections. These eyelid wipes from Biotrue contain no preservatives or detergents and aid the gentle soothing of your eyes. With Biotrue Daily Eyelid Wipes you can expect your eyes to remain fresh over the course of the day.”

tired eyes

They are easy to use, single-use, to keep them as safe and as hygienic as possible, and they really do help relieve irritated and sore eyes and are useful as part of your eye care regime if you are prone to eye infections or irritations.
